Understanding GamStop
GamStop is a self-exclusion scheme launched in the UK to help players manage their gambling habits. Websites participating in this program allow players to voluntarily exclude themselves from online gambling for a specified period. Responsible Gaming Practices
Regardless of whether you choose to play at a GamStop-regulated casino or one that is not, responsible gaming remains crucial. Here are some best practices:
- Set a Budget: Establish clear limits on how much you are willing to spend before you start playing.
- Stay Informed: Keep track of your playing time and spending to avoid falling into unhealthy patterns.
- Know When to Stop: If you find yourself chasing losses or playing more than you intended, take a break.
- Seek Help if Needed: If you believe you might have a gambling problem, don’t hesitate to seek assistance from gambling support organizations.
